Daryl Masuda
As you enter you are greeted by an open and spacious space. The sushi bar area is nicely decorated and looks well maintained. The entire restaurant is meticulously clean with everything in its place.

Service is attentive and gracious. I ordered the Chicken Karaage Curry and my mom ordered the Salmon Collar. When our food arrived it looked fantastic. The Chicken Karaage looked really crunchy. I ate a piece off the top and it was extremely crunchy, my expectations were high. I dipped a piece of chicken into the curry sauce, but the sauce seemed bland. As I ate it was clear the chicken was incredible, but the curry sauce was broken. There were multiple signs of separation. Some parts were watery and bland, other parts were thicker with stronger flavor. In the picture separation can be seen around the edges of the sauce. Another issue is the rice was room temperature and the grains were starting to tighten and did not mix well with the curry sauce. The disappointing thing is both issues could have easily been fixed before serving. The curry sauce was an easy fix and the rice just had to be warmed. Small things really do make a big difference. I would give the Chicken Karaage alone a 5 out of 5, but with the curry sauce and rice, I would knock that down to a 3.5 out of 5. If everything was freshly made I’m sure it would have been a 5 out of 5.

This is a Sushi Bar and I didn’t even try the sushi, so I can’t say much about it. However, the prices are very reasonable and definitely worth a try.

Overall the issues were minor. So, this is a place worthy of a shot.
